start thinking about table Update()

This commit is contained in:
Jeff Carr 2025-03-03 12:00:04 -06:00
parent b61cf9902e
commit 547e67042d
1 changed files with 6 additions and 2 deletions

View File

@ -93,7 +93,7 @@ func (grid *Node) makeGridLabel(pb *guipb.Widget, w int, h int) *Node {
} }
func (me *TreeInfo) updateTable(t *guipb.Table) { func (me *TreeInfo) updateTable(t *guipb.Table) {
log.Info("todo: compare table here...") // log.Info("todo: compare table here...")
for _, name := range t.Order { for _, name := range t.Order {
me.updateRow(t, name) me.updateRow(t, name)
} }
@ -108,7 +108,7 @@ func (me *TreeInfo) updateRow(t *guipb.Table, name string) {
// if n == nil { // if n == nil {
// log.Info("could not find widget id", id) // log.Info("could not find widget id", id)
// } // }
// log.Info("tree.updateRow() start found header", id, r.Header, "len =", len(r.Widgets)) log.Info("tree.updateRow(string)", r.Header, "len =", len(r.Widgets))
// if r.Header.Name == "Hostname" { // if r.Header.Name == "Hostname" {
// } // }
// log.Info("tree.updateRow() found Hostnames", r.Vals) // log.Info("tree.updateRow() found Hostnames", r.Vals)
@ -124,6 +124,9 @@ func (me *TreeInfo) updateRow(t *guipb.Table, name string) {
} }
me.SetText(n, v) me.SetText(n, v)
} }
if r.Header.Name == "CurrentBranchName" {
log.Info("tree: check:", i, v, "vs", w.Name, w.Id)
}
} }
return return
} }
@ -133,6 +136,7 @@ func (me *TreeInfo) updateRow(t *guipb.Table, name string) {
if name != r.Header.Name { if name != r.Header.Name {
continue continue
} }
log.Info("tree.updateRow(time)", r.Header, "len =", len(r.Widgets))
for i, _ := range r.Vals { for i, _ := range r.Vals {
// log.Info("tree: Hostname Widget", i, v, w.Name) // log.Info("tree: Hostname Widget", i, v, w.Name)
w := r.Widgets[i] w := r.Widgets[i]